MAZAPILITE [1 record]

Record 1 2011-06-15

English

Subject field(s)
  • Mineralogy
DEF

A black orthorhombic mineral which consists of a hydrous arsenate of calcium and iron, closely related to arseniosiderite.

OBS

Named after the locality of Mazapil, Zacatecas, Mexico.
